On a related issue, it looks to me that the compiler itself should be
compiled with -funwind-tables, otherwise there are no backtraces
generated, even if libbacktrace is linked in and operational. Again,
x86_64-linux-gnu host defaults to this flag, but other hosts are left
behind.
